O mais provável é que esteja usando o rhnplugin para acessar o "RHN Classic". Para desativar um repositório (cancelar a inscrição em um canal), use o comando rhn-channel
ou a interface da Web em link
Ajudar alguém que herdou seu ambiente. Ele quer desabilitar alguns repositórios. Esta é uma saída anônima de seu yum repolist
:
luke@server1 $ sudo yum repolist
Loaded plugins: rhnplugin, security
This system is receiving updates from RHN Classic or RHN Satellite.
repo id repo name status
acme-rhel-x86-64-server-5 ACME Packages (v.5 for 64-bit) 1
epel Extra Packages for Enterprise Linux 5 - x86_64 7,745
rhel-x86_64-server-5 Red Hat Enterprise Linux (v. 5 for 64-bit x86_64) 16,133
rhn-tools-rhel-x86_64-server-5 Red Hat Network Tools for RHEL Server (v.5 64-bit x86_64) 564
repolist: 24,443
No entanto, fazer o seguinte não produz resultados:
luke@server1 $ grep -ri acme /etc/yum.repos.d /etc/yum/pluginconf.d
O mais provável é que esteja usando o rhnplugin para acessar o "RHN Classic". Para desativar um repositório (cancelar a inscrição em um canal), use o comando rhn-channel
ou a interface da Web em link
Embora .repo
arquivos geralmente sejam colocados em /etc/yum.repos.d
, você pode especificar um diretório diferente usando reposdir=xxx
in /etc/yum.conf
.
Se você está registrado no Satellite (você tem uma assinatura do rhn-tools, então estou apostando que este é o caso), o repositório ACME é provavelmente um canal filho no qual o seu sistema está inscrito e, nesse caso, ele está disponível para yum
por meio do módulo rhnplugin
que enumera todos os canais nos quais você está inscrito e apresenta ao yum como se fossem repositórios.
O nome do repo também se parece com um ID de canal satélite, mas isso é apenas um palpite com base em como o nome está estruturado.
Você pode confirmar com o comando rhn-channel
:
root@xxxxxxlp03 ~ $ rhn-channel -l
epel6-64bit
rhel-x86_64-server-6
rhn-tools-rhel-x86_64-server-6
Tags package-management yum rhel